Variables, Expressions, and Integers

Term
Definition
Numerical Expression   Consists of numbers and operations  
🗑
Variable   A letter used to represent one or more numbers  
🗑
Variable Expression   Consists of numbers, variables, and operations  
🗑
Evaluate   A variable expression, substitute a number for each variable and evaluate the resulting numerical expression  
🗑
Verbal Model   Describes a problem using words as labels and using math symbols to relate the words  
🗑
Power   Is the result of a repeated multiplication of the same factor  
🗑
Base   The base is the big number  
🗑
Exponent   The exponent is the small number in the top corner of the base  
🗑
Order of Operations   To evaluate expressions involving more than one operation, mathematicians have agreed on a set of rules  
🗑
Integers   Are the numbers...,-3, -2, -1, 0, 1, 2, 3,...(The dots indicate that the numbers continue without end in both the positive and negative directions)  
🗑
Negative Integers   Are integers that are less than 0  
🗑
Positive Integers   Are integers that are greater than 0  
🗑
Absolute Value   A number is its distance from 0 on the number line  
🗑
Opposite   They have the same absolute values but different signs  
🗑
Additive Inverse   The opposite of a number  
🗑
Mean   The sum of the values divided by the numbers of values  
🗑
Median   The middle value when the values are written in numerical order  
🗑
Mode   The value that occurs most often  
🗑
Range   The difference of the greatest value and the least value  
🗑
Coordinate Plane   Formed by the intersection of a horizontal number line called the x-axis and a vertical number line called the y-axis.  
🗑
Order Pair   Each point in a coordinate plane is represented by an ordered pair  
🗑
Scatter Plot   Uses a coordinate plane to display paired data
